I currently have a non-HD TV. I do have a decent sound system with ability to connect an Apple TV with an optical connection. Since I will eventually buy an HD TV, could I buy an Apple TV now and just connect to my receiver? I really want to listen to my music using Air Play. I have two 4s phones, IPad 2 and ITunes on my Windows computer. I need help! Thanks.

You would still need a way to set up the apple tv so I would be hard anytime u wanted to play music I would look into a airport express is has a audio line out and can make your system AirPlay capable

I have both an Apple TV connected to one reveiver using an optical and I also have an AirPort Express connected to another receiver using jacks. I can play my itunes songs using the app Remote (Apple, free) from my iTouch and can choose to play the songs from the Apple TV home theater speaker OR the bookshelf stereo speakers OR both at the same time (which is really cool, 8 speakers).

if you have a dvi monitor you could get an hdmi to DVI cable and use that to setup the connection prefs etc. on the ATV and then hook it to your receiver for audio playback.

if you jailbreak you can install the vnc app for the ATV and view the screen from your computer without a TV hooked to the ATV over your network if you need to trouble shoot any issues.
